## Executive Summary **PancakeSwap's** official Chinese **X account** was compromised on **October 8, 2025**, promoting a fraudulent "Mr. Pancake" meme coin, yet its native **CAKE token** saw an unexpected price increase amid the incident. ## The Event in Detail On **October 8, 2025**, **PancakeSwap**, a prominent decentralized exchange on the **BNB Chain**, confirmed that its official Chinese-language **X account** (@PancakeSwapzh) had been compromised via a targeted phishing attack. The attackers leveraged the compromised account to promote a fraudulent meme coin, interchangeably referred to as "Mr. Pancake" or "Sir Pancake." This scam involved deceptive posts advertising phony airdrops and "official" token launches, directing users to imposter websites that mimicked **PancakeSwap's** legitimate platform, often using subtle domain swaps (e.g., replacing "i" with "l"). Upon connecting their cryptocurrency wallets to these fraudulent sites, victims’ funds were instantly drained through malicious smart contract approvals. The scam token managed to generate over **$20 million** in trading volume before the deception was fully exposed. While **PancakeSwap** stated that no user funds or platform assets were directly affected on its core platform, some individual traders reported losses ranging from **$8,000 to $13,000** from the scam. The **PancakeSwap** team responded by deleting the malicious posts, issuing warnings from its main **X account** (@PancakeSwap), and initiating a full investigation, reassuring users that all funds on the main platform remained secure while committing to strengthening account security measures. ## Market Implications Despite the significant security breach, **PancakeSwap's** native **CAKE token** exhibited a counter-intuitive market reaction. Following the news of the hack, **CAKE** gained between **6.4% and 16%** in 24 hours, reaching an intraday high of **$4.52**. This resilience contrasts with the inherent risks highlighted by the incident, suggesting a market that, for **CAKE** specifically, remained largely unperturbed by the social media compromise itself, focusing instead on broader market dynamics or underlying platform fundamentals. The incident, however, underscores a persistent vulnerability across the cryptocurrency ecosystem, particularly for official social media channels. It follows a similar compromise of **BNB Chain's X account** just a week prior, prompting warnings from **Binance** co-founder **Changpeng 'CZ' Zhao**. This pattern indicates that "Binance-related projects," as noted by industry observers, have become frequent targets, leading to cautious market sentiment regarding the security of official communication channels for crypto projects. ## Expert Commentary Industry experts have weighed in on the increasing frequency of such attacks. **Shān Zhang**, Chief Information Security Officer at blockchain security firm **Slowmist**, observed that "The **BNB meme coin market** is very hot these days," making it a lucrative target for scammers. Zhang attributed the prevalence of social media hacks to "weak security awareness" among many account controllers and their susceptibility to "phishing attacks." **Lisa**, Security Operations Lead at **SlowMist**, emphasized the necessity for heightened user vigilance, stating, "Users must be informed, skeptical, and security-minded at all times." Further, **Yu Xian**, CEO of **SlowMist**, highlighted emerging sophisticated tactics, including new scam methods involving fake **Zoom software** and "frighteningly real" **AI deepfakes** used to deceive victims. **Arda Akartuna**, Lead Crypto Threat Researcher at **Elliptic**, underscored the escalating nature of the threat: "Criminals are scaling their operations with **AI**. So we are also scaling our tools to fight back." ## Broader Context and Security Landscape The **PancakeSwap** hack is indicative of a broader trend where high-profile social media accounts are targeted to perpetrate financial fraud within the crypto space. Precedents include the compromise of **FC Barcelona's Instagram account** to promote a fraudulent **$FCB token** and a similar incident involving **Disney's Instagram** in **October 2025**. These attacks exploit the credibility of established entities to execute pump-and-dump schemes. The proliferation of **AI deepfakes** has significantly fueled a new wave of sophisticated scams. The 2025 Anti-Scam Research Report indicates global losses to crypto scams surged to **$4.6 billion in 2024**, with **Chainalysis** reporting figures as high as **$9.9 billion** for the same year. In the first quarter of **2025** alone, at least **87 AI-driven scam rings** were dismantled, employing synthetic videos, fake video calls, and deepfake impersonations. Criminals are also using cross-chain bridges and obfuscation tools to launder stolen funds, complicating recovery efforts. In response to these escalating threats, platforms are bolstering their defenses. **PancakeSwap Infinity**, for instance, has strategically partnered with **Hexens**, a Web3 cybersecurity company, to conduct rigorous multi-layered audits of its smart contracts, aiming to normalize robust **DeFi** security practices. Additionally, the adoption of **decentralized identity architectures**, such as **Verifiable Credentials**, is being explored as a method to mitigate fraud. These solutions enable cryptographically tamper-proof digital credentials bound to individuals, incorporating biometrics to counter phishing, synthetic identities, and deepfakes, offering a more secure and cost-effective authentication and fraud prevention framework for the digital economy.
## Executive Summary PancakeSwap, the leading decentralized exchange on the **BNB Chain**, has officially launched **CakePad**, a new platform for early token access. This development marks a significant evolution from its previous Initial Farm Offerings (IFOs), aiming to streamline user participation in new token launches. A core feature of **CakePad** is the immediate and complete burning of all participation fees, a mechanism designed to reinforce the deflationary trajectory of **PancakeSwap**'s native **CAKE** token as part of its **Tokenomics 3.0** strategy. ## The Event in Detail **CakePad** enables users to gain early access to new tokens before their general exchange listings. Unlike traditional launchpads or its predecessor IFOs, **CakePad** allows any wallet holder to commit **CAKE** during a sale window and subsequently claim new assets without the requirement for staking or lock-ups. This approach contrasts with common practices observed in platforms like **Binance**'s Launchpad/Launchpool, which typically necessitate locking exchange tokens or accumulating platform points. **PancakeSwap** has stated, "No staking. No lock-ups. Just commit CAKE and claim new tokens." Additionally, a "fair tiered subscription tax" mechanism is implemented for oversubscribed sales, with the tax rate designed to decrease as the degree of oversubscription rises. ## Financial Mechanics and Tokenomics Central to **CakePad**'s design is its direct impact on **CAKE** tokenomics. **PancakeSwap** has committed to burning 100% of all participation fees collected through **CakePad** events. This mechanism is a key component of **CAKE Tokenomics 3.0**, a broader effort to enhance the utility and drive the supply reduction of the **CAKE** token. The platform has outlined a long-term goal of achieving an approximate 4% annual deflation rate and an estimated 20% reduction in the total **CAKE** supply by 2030 through ongoing buyback-and-burn initiatives. The current hard cap for **CAKE** supply is set at 450 million, a reduction from a previous cap of 750 million, following a successful proposal in December 2023. ## Business Strategy and Market Positioning The introduction of **CakePad** represents a strategic move by **PancakeSwap** to differentiate its decentralized launchpad offering within a competitive market. By eliminating staking and lock-up requirements, **PancakeSwap** aims to lower barriers to entry and broaden user participation, thereby increasing the utility of **CAKE**. This strategy seeks to attract both new users and projects to the **PancakeSwap** ecosystem, positioning **CakePad** as an accessible alternative to more restrictive centralized and decentralized early-access platforms. The focus on direct **CAKE** burning also aligns the platform's growth with the long-term value proposition of its native token. ## Broader Market Implications **CakePad**'s launch could establish a new benchmark for decentralized early token access platforms, potentially influencing other decentralized exchanges to adopt similar models that prioritize user accessibility and direct token deflation. The sustained burning of **CAKE** tokens through participation fees is expected to create continuous deflationary pressure, which could positively influence investor sentiment and long-term demand for **CAKE**. This initiative further solidifies **PancakeSwap**'s position within the **DeFi** landscape, building on its previous performance as a leader among **DeFi** exchanges in spot trading volume.
## Executive Summary Bitcoin has established a new all-time high, surpassing $125,000, reflecting robust market demand and increasing institutional engagement within the digital asset sector. This milestone coincides with heightened anticipation for a potential Solana Exchange Traded Fund (ETF) approval, which is expected to further integrate digital assets into traditional finance. Concurrently, major financial institutions like Morgan Stanley are deepening their involvement in cryptocurrency services, while new Web3 initiatives like MetaMask's "Ways to Earn" program aim to boost user activity. The total cryptocurrency market capitalization stands at approximately $4.21 trillion, with Bitcoin's dominance at 59.34%. ## The Event in Detail **Bitcoin's Price Milestone:** The leading cryptocurrency, **Bitcoin (BTC)**, achieved a new record, touching highs around $125,400 before trading near $123,000. This surpasses the previous peak of $124,480 set in August, marking a significant rally that has seen BTC bounce over 13% in the past seven days. Citigroup projects Bitcoin to reach $133,000 by the end of 2025, driven by inflows from spot ETFs and digital asset treasury allocations. JPMorgan analysts anticipate a target of $165,000 in 2025, aligning with gold's market capitalization, while Standard Chartered remains the most optimistic, forecasting $200,000 by December, citing weekly ETF inflows exceeding $500 million. VanEck suggests a target of $180,000 by 2025, linking it to post-halving dynamics and ETF demand. **Solana ETF Anticipation:** The crypto market is closely monitoring the imminent decision regarding a **Solana (SOL) ETF**. Bloomberg senior analyst Eric Balchunas has increased the odds of approval to 100%, with October 10 marked as the final deadline for the U.S. SEC. This comes amidst reports of substantial **SOL whale movements**, including a transfer of 400,000 SOL valued over $92 million from Binance to a wallet. The price of SOL, recently trading around $226.315, has surged over 18% in a week, breaking resistance levels at $211 and $222. Analysts predict potential rallies to $300-$400, or even $520, upon approval, with a confirmed breakout above $260 seen as a key trigger. Morgan Stanley plans to offer Solana trading to its clients via its E-Trade platform by the first half of 2026. **MetaMask's "Ways to Earn" Initiative:** **MetaMask** is preparing to launch a new "Ways to Earn" rewards feature, integrated into its main codebase. This program will incentivize user trading activity, offering 80 points for every $100 in spot trades and 10 points for every $100 in perpetuals. Additionally, 250 points will be awarded for each $1,250 in historical trading volume. Activities on the **LINEA network** will receive increased points, with over $30 million in reward tokens of LINEA to be distributed in the first season. The initiative, set to go live in October 2025, signifies MetaMask's entry into the Web3 loyalty space and is expected to have meaningful connectivity with a future MASK token. **Institutional Digital Asset Treasury Growth:** VanEck's report highlights the substantial growth of the Digital Asset Treasury (DAT) sector to approximately $135 billion. This indicates a trend of institutions accumulating and staking **Ethereum (ETH)**, with VanEck also registering the Lido Staked Ethereum (stETH) ETF Trust in Delaware. This increasing institutional staking, while signaling long-term commitment, also raises potential dilution risks for non-stakers. Morgan Stanley's strategic foray into crypto includes plans to offer direct trading of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Solana to its E*Trade clients starting in the first half of 2026, supported by a partnership with infrastructure provider Zerohash. This move represents an expansion of services that began with offering Bitcoin funds to wealthy clients in 2021 and enabling wealth advisors to recommend spot Bitcoin ETFs in 2024. **Aster's Wash Trading Allegations:** **DeFiLlama** has announced the removal of **Aster's** perpetual trading statistics from its platform due to concerns over wash trading. DeFiLlama's founder, 0xngmi, cited an almost 1:1 correlation between Aster's trading pairs (e.g., XRPUSDT and ETHUSDT) and Binance's trading patterns. This decision was made to preserve data integrity, as the team lacked access to low-level execution data to confirm the nature of the mirrored volumes. Following 0xngmi's comments, the native ASTER token experienced a 10% decline, dropping from $2 to $1.8. **U.S. Government Shutdown Impact:** The recent U.S. government shutdown, the first in nearly seven years, has introduced an element of uncertainty into the market. While Bitcoin has shown resilience, acting as a safe haven asset during the shutdown by rebounding from $114K lows to $116K, the halt in non-essential federal services could delay crypto regulation, ETF approvals, and legislative progress. Agencies such as the SEC and CFTC ceasing non-essential operations may prolong reviews for various crypto ETFs, including those for Solana and Ethereum. ## Market Implications Bitcoin's new all-time high underscores the cryptocurrency's growing maturity and appeal as a store of value, attracting continued capital inflows from both retail and institutional investors. ## Executive Summary On October 3, 2025, the cryptocurrency market demonstrated significant short-term volatility. **PancakeSwap (CAKE)** emerged as the leading gainer among the top 100 cryptocurrencies by market capitalization, recording a 37.68% increase. This surge was primarily attributed to shifting liquidity following **Binance's** decision to delist **Tether (USDT)** due to EU regulatory compliance issues, alongside a revitalized meme coin sector on the **Binance Smart Chain (BNB Chain)**. Conversely, **MYX Finance (MYX)** experienced the largest decline, dropping 32.53%, linked to a rapid unwinding of leverage. Other notable movements included **ether.fi (ETHFI)**, **SPX6900 (SPX)**, **Zcash (ZEC)**, and **BNB** registering substantial gains, while **DoubleZero (2Z)** also saw a significant downturn. The broader market sentiment remained mixed, indicative of underlying uncertainty despite some assets showing strong momentum. ## The Event in Detail **PancakeSwap (CAKE)** recorded a 37.68% gain in 24 hours, reaching a price of $2.49, marking a 57% increase over the past week. This performance was largely influenced by **Binance's** delisting of **Tether (USDT)**, slated for March 31, due to non-compliance with the EU's Markets in Crypto Assets (MiCA) regulations. The delisting prompted a significant migration of **USDT** holdings, with **PancakeSwap** processing over $346 million in **USDT** volume within 24 hours, constituting approximately 54% of its total trading volume. This influx propelled **PancakeSwap's** overall trading volume to $647 million in a single day, securing 61% of the decentralized exchange (DEX) market share and surpassing competitors like **Ethereum**-based **Uniswap**. Additionally, the **BNB Chain** ecosystem observed a resurgence in meme coin activity, with the sector growing by 48% in the past week to a capitalization of $2.71 billion. The **Mubarak (MUBARAK)** meme coin, for example, saw a 56% increase, briefly hitting a $150 million market cap and contributing over 12% to **PancakeSwap's** daily trading volume. This collective activity pushed **CAKE's** market capitalization into the top 100 cryptocurrencies. Beyond **PancakeSwap**, other significant gainers included **ether.fi (ETHFI)**, which rose by 16.47% to $1.78, and **SPX6900 (SPX)**, gaining 11.59% to reach $1.33. **Zcash (ZEC)** saw a 9.54% increase, trading at $148.29. **BNB** posted a 9.40% gain, reaching $1,137.99, underpinned by strong institutional interest and network enhancements. Conversely, **MYX Finance (MYX)** experienced the most substantial decline among top assets, plummeting 32.53%, with some reports indicating a 43% fall due to a rapid unwinding of leverage. **DoubleZero (2Z)** saw a 10.25% decrease, although its initial launch was marred by a 65% collapse after an apparent discrepancy of 2.77 billion unexpected tokens flooded the market, vastly exceeding its stated circulating supply. Other notable losers included **MemeCore (M)**, down 3.77%, **Flare (FLR)**, declining 3.07%, and **Monero (XMR)**, which decreased by 2.06%. ## Market Implications The observed market dynamics carry significant implications for the broader Web3 ecosystem and investor sentiment. **PancakeSwap's** surge demonstrates how regulatory pressures on centralized exchanges can drive liquidity and trading volume towards decentralized platforms, particularly those with robust ecosystems like **BNB Chain**. This shift underscores the increasing importance of DEXs as alternatives for traders navigating evolving compliance landscapes. The strong performance of **BNB** highlights a growing trend of institutional adoption, mirroring the corporate treasury strategies previously seen with **Bitcoin**. Entities such as Kazakhstan's Ministry of AI designating **BNB** as a primary reserve asset, **Windtree Therapeutics** allocating 99% of its $520 million raise to **BNB**, and **Nano Labs** building a $1 billion **BNB** treasury illustrate a strategic move to integrate cryptocurrencies into corporate balance sheets. Furthermore, the **BNB Chain's Maxwell upgrade**, which reduced gas fees by 50% and accelerated block times, positions it as a more competitive platform against high-speed networks, potentially attracting more developers and fostering DeFi growth. The sharp declines of tokens like **MYX** and **DoubleZero** serve as a cautionary example regarding market liquidity, leverage risks, and tokenomics transparency. The **DoubleZero** incident, specifically, where an unannounced increase in circulating supply led to a massive sell-off, underscores the critical need for clear and accurate token distribution information to maintain investor confidence and market integrity. ## Broader Context The current crypto market environment is characterized by a dynamic interplay of regulatory developments, technological advancements, and speculative investor behavior. **Bitcoin's** stabilization above the $119,000 mark and the potential for an "Uptober" rally, alongside increased investor interest in major altcoins, suggest a maturing ecosystem.
